Emily's Walk for Work & Grow

Emily Dougherty, Easterseals development assistant, celebrated her love of Irish culture by taking a 3.6 mile walk on the Loveland Trail on St. Patrick's Day.

​The walk distance of 3.6 miles signified the nearly 3600 mile distance between Cincinnati and Dublin. Because her family St. Patrick's Day celebration was thwarted by the pandemic, Emily wanted to do something fun but that also made a difference - a walk for good. With a wonderful outpouring of support from family and friends, Emily raised over $5,000 for Easterseals Work & Grow Summer Camps!

​Emily shared her reason for wanting to help young adults living with disabilities.

"As someone on the autism spectrum who has struggled with OCD and anxiety my whole life, it felt SO good when I finally got a job. Employment is such a great opportunity for many reasons, but it can also seem intimidating for those who struggle with various disabilities. That’s why I am hoping to raise $2,000 for Easterseals’ Work & Grow Summer Camp, so young adults with disabilities can learn valuable skills that will help them on the road to employment – because EVERYONE deserves this opportunity to thrive in their community!"


Kudos to Emily for smashing your goal and making dreams come true for campers this summer!

Just like everyone, 2020 left many young adults living with intellectual and developmental  disabilities without regular activites like going to school or work. Easterseals created a solution for those who are safely able to participate in community activities.

In 2021, we've expanded our Work and Grow Summer Camps for people ages 16-25 to come together for job skills training, fun and friendship.
